Kinds Of Regional Moving Services

When thinking about local movers, have you ever stopped briefly to think of the range of services tucked under that easy expression? Moving isn't almost hauling boxes from point A to point B. It's a symphony of choices, each tailored to different needs, budgets, and way of lives. Imagine your valuables as characters in a story-- every one requiring a various sort of care and attention.

Full-Service Moving

This is the all-encompassing choice. Photo this: you turn over your secrets and concerns, and the movers take charge of everything-- from loading vulnerable heirlooms to carefully filling and discharging the truck. It's like having an individual moving concierge. This service frequently consists of:

  • Packing and unpacking
  • Disassembly and reassembly of furniture
  • Filling, transportation, and dumping

DIY with Moving Truck Rental

Ever had a good friend state, "I'll help you move if you cover the pizza"? This option feels a bit like that-- rolling up your sleeves and calling in favors, but with the muscle of a leased truck. You manage the packing, filling, and driving, which can be an excellent method to remain in control and conserve cash. Be careful-- the physical toll can slip up on you like an unforeseen storm.

Labor-Only Moving Services

Often, you simply require a few additional hands. Labor-only services provide muscle without the truck. Movers appear to assist with heavy lifting, packing, or unloading, while you manage the transport. It's ideal for those who have access to a vehicle however want to evade the backache and awkward sofa maneuvering.

Specialized Moving

Have you ever tried to move a grand piano or a classic arcade game? Specialized moving services cater to those special products that demand delicate handling and know-how. These movers use specialized devices and strategies to guarantee your treasured possessions show up unscathed. Consider it the VIP treatment for your valuables.

Storage-Integrated Moving

In some cases, timing does not align completely. You may be in between homes or downsizing. Storage-integrated services combine moving with brief- or long-lasting storage options. It's like providing your valuables a short-term rest stop, complete with security and environment control, up until you're ready to invite them into your brand-new area.

Service Type Best For Secret Includes
Full-Service Moving Those looking for benefit and care Packaging, loading, transportation, unpacking
DIY Truck Rental Budget-conscious movers with time Self-managed packing, packing, and driving
Labor-Only Services Movers requiring assist with heavy lifting Professional movers for loading/unloading only
Specialty Moving Owners of delicate or oversized items Expert handling and specific equipment
Storage-Integrated Moving Those requiring short-term storage solutions Secure storage combined with moving services

Packing and Preparation Tips for Regional Movers

Have you ever attempted to stuff a lifetime of memories into cardboard boxes? It can seem like trying to capture smoke with your bare hands. When working with local movers, the secret isn't simply speed but precision-- the kind that turns mayhem into order before the truck even pulls up.

Strategize Your Packaging

Start by classifying products not simply by space, but by fragility and frequency of usage. Ever discovered yourself desperately looking for your coffee machine on moving day? Avoid that by labeling boxes clearly with sharpie and using color-coded sticker labels. Here's a fast professional suggestion:



  • Vulnerable items: Wrap in bubble wrap or perhaps soft clothes like t-shirts.
  • Heavy items: Load in smaller boxes to lower pressure-- this keeps movers effective and your back sane.
  • Fundamentals: Pack a "first-night" box with toiletries, treats, battery chargers, and fundamental tools.

Take Full Advantage Of Area and Safety

Did you know that packing a hollow area inside furnishings or shoes with smaller items can conserve an unexpected amount of space? Not just does it enhance volume, but it likewise cushions fragile possessions. On the other hand, overstuffed boxes can burst open mid-transport, leading to a domino impact of mishaps.

Packing Material Best Usage Pro Tip
Bubble Wrap Glassware, ceramics Double-wrap for additional protection on irregular shapes
Moving Blankets Furnishings, large electronics Protect with stretch wrap or tape to prevent slipping
Stretch Wrap Keep drawers and doors closed Wrap around furnishings legs to prevent scratches

Timing and Coordination

Why rush loading the day before? The finest movers typically say, "The click here clock is your opponent." Start packing non-essential items weeks beforehand. By the time movers get here, your home must feel less like a whirlwind and more like a well-rehearsed play. Ever wondered why some moves feel seamless while others end up being an experience? Preparation is the secret active ingredient.

Final List Before Movers Arrive

  1. Verify all boxes are sealed and identified.
  2. Dismantle large furnishings if possible to accelerate loading.
  3. Clear paths to make bring easier and more secure.
  4. Keep valuables and important files with you.
  5. Interact any unique directions or vulnerable products to your movers.

Unanticipated Difficulties in Local Moving

Think of the minute you recognize that the relatively straightforward task of moving down the street is a labyrinth of surprise challenges. One of the most overlooked problems is the timing-- not just the day of the move, but the hours when traffic surges or parking restrictions snap into action. Ever tried unloading a truck in a dynamic community without any offered areas? It's a timeless circumstance that turns a simple relocation into a logistical puzzle.

Space management inside the moving lorry is another subtle art. You might believe, "I'll just stack everything up," however without a strategic strategy, fragile products become casualties, and valuable square video gets squandered. Pro movers swear by the "Tetris" technique-- fitting boxes and furniture like puzzle pieces to take full advantage of capability and minimize damage.

Typical Local Moving Snags

  • Narrow entrances and staircases: Browsing large furniture typically requires creative angles and extra hands.
  • Unexpected weather shifts: Unexpected rain or heat can damage packing materials and mover stamina.
  • Concealed fees: When the relocation extends beyond the original scope, costs can sneak up all of a sudden.
  • Last-minute schedule changes: Movers and customers both balancing calendars can cause delays or hurried decisions.

Professional Tips to Outsmart Moving Day Surprises

  1. Reserve parking allows early: If your brand-new or old address has strict parking guidelines, protecting a license ahead guarantees smooth filling and dumping.
  2. Label boxes with in-depth content notes: This accelerates unpacking and minimizes the risk of mishandling.
  3. Dismantle big furniture: Taking apart beds, tables, or shelves can make tight areas manageable.
  4. Load an essentials bag: Keep prized possessions and immediate needs separate to avoid frenzied searches.
